Unauthenticated PHP execution via unescaped installer replacement
Published Jan 8, 2024 · Updated Jun 3, 2025
Code injection in Snap Creek LLC Duplicator before 1.3.0 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P via a leftover installer. The installer.php database-replacement step inserts an unescaped url_new value into wp-config.php, allowing attacker-supplied PHP statements to be written. Unauthenticated access is sufficient when installer.php or installer-backup.php remains web-accessible after migration; the injected statements execute as site code.
